WebMay 15, 2015 · The size in logical extents (set with lvcreate -l «number-of-extents») is just a way to specify the size of the logical volume. LV size = physical extent size * number of extents. WebMar 17, 2013 · Yes, Less.js introduced extend in v1.4.0. :extend () Rather than implementing the at-rule ( @extend) syntax used by SASS and Stylus, LESS implemented the pseudo-class syntax, which gives LESS's implementation the flexibility to be applied either directly to a selector itself, or inside a statement.
